Show All Tags causes table to disappear

Switching between Normal and Show All Tags and back to Normal causes table element to disappear from view. Only cure is to re-open page. Problem is seen with pages contain this extract. <BODY> <TABLE WIDTH=100% BORDER=0 CELLPADDING=0 CELLSPACING=0 STYLE="page-break-before: always"> <COL WIDTH=7*> <COL WIDTH=95*> <COL WIDTH=154*> <TR VALIGN=TOP> ...
